О, вы как обладатель MBP Retina 13'', скажите пожалуйста — как вообще ноутбук, сильно ли лагает интерфейс?
Сегодня зашел в магазин, рядом поставили MBA 2013 13" и MBP Retina 2013 13" — то ли я уже реально поверил в его глючность, то ли прошка действительно тормозит из-за такого разрешения?
Уже на грани покупки, но боюсь сделать плохой выбор. Спасибо.
Здорове, спасибо за отзыв. Ветку про матрицу читал, печально это.
Еще, конечно, хорошо было бы услышать отзыв от разработчика, имеющего MBP Retina 13 — чтобы уж окончательно определиться.
А вам разрешения Эира хватает? Мне почему-то кажется по сравнению с ретиной слишком мало влазит на экран всего.
А для вебдевелопера — то? Я всё сомневаюсь в выборе MPA 2013 vs MBP retina 13. Хватает ли вам разрешения экрана Air для программирования? Оперативной памяти?
Чем больше читаю про MBP Retina 13 тем меньше хочется его купить. Как вы считаете, эир для разработки подходит, если взять с 8Гб оперативной памяти? У коллеги с 4Гб версии 2011 — вроде как маловато уже.
Установил. Альфа говорит сама за себя. Много пока что багов, но реализация впринципе понравились. Насколько я понял, поддерживается пока только Git (Github, Bitbucket, локальный репозиторий).
Не понравился процесс установки, когда не видно какой package ставит composer.
Вам не кажется, что $something и true чем-то отличаются? Если мне не нужно возвращать $something, а я хочу именно true, то что?
Вы правы, чем-то отличаются. Если вы хотите именно true, то правильный вариант на мой взгляд уже написал PQR
return (bool)$something;
Народ, вы либо устали, либо серьёзно считаете, что писать else после return это нормально? Какой смысл ставить else, если return возвращает результат и код дальше не исполняется?
Согласен с Вами, но я бы код все-таки написал так:
1. Если надо вернуть boolean:
...
return (bool)$something;
2. Если надо вернуть некоторый результат:
...
if ($something) {
return $newValue;
}
return $defaultValue;
<?php
class My_Date {
// Пусть в моей системе будет только один справочник со списком месяцев
public static $months = array('Январь', 'Февраль', ...);
// Сделал бы его константой класса, но константы не могут быть массивами :(
}
Немного не по теме статьи, но в таких случаях, возможно, лучше использовать SplEnum, который позволяет нативно получить список всех констант класса в виде массива с помощью метода getConstList().
Пример из документации по ссылке как раз класс с месяцами.
Скромно, но поддержал на бумстартере.
Сегодня зашел в магазин, рядом поставили MBA 2013 13" и MBP Retina 2013 13" — то ли я уже реально поверил в его глючность, то ли прошка действительно тормозит из-за такого разрешения?
Уже на грани покупки, но боюсь сделать плохой выбор. Спасибо.
Еще, конечно, хорошо было бы услышать отзыв от разработчика, имеющего MBP Retina 13 — чтобы уж окончательно определиться.
А вам разрешения Эира хватает? Мне почему-то кажется по сравнению с ретиной слишком мало влазит на экран всего.
Чем больше читаю про MBP Retina 13 тем меньше хочется его купить. Как вы считаете, эир для разработки подходит, если взять с 8Гб оперативной памяти? У коллеги с 4Гб версии 2011 — вроде как маловато уже.
azverin, добавьте пожалуйста в пост. Про Git вообще очень удобно.
Установил. Альфа говорит сама за себя. Много пока что багов, но реализация впринципе понравились. Насколько я понял, поддерживается пока только Git (Github, Bitbucket, локальный репозиторий).
Не понравился процесс установки, когда не видно какой package ставит composer.
Но думаю получится в итоге неплохо.
Вы правы, чем-то отличаются. Если вы хотите именно true, то правильный вариант на мой взгляд уже написал PQR
Согласен с Вами, но я бы код все-таки написал так:
1. Если надо вернуть boolean:
2. Если надо вернуть некоторый результат:
отвечают долго, но отвечают.
А вообще, если есть возможность, попробуйте phpQuery
Немного не по теме статьи, но в таких случаях, возможно, лучше использовать SplEnum, который позволяет нативно получить список всех констант класса в виде массива с помощью метода
getConstList()
.Пример из документации по ссылке как раз класс с месяцами.